Q
What compensation can be claimed for medical negligence?

Ask a Work Claims lawyer in Parkwood

Compensation for medical negligence can cover med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and future care costs.;In some cases, compensation for loss of enjoyment of life and psychological harm may also be awarded.

Q
How does arbitration differ from mediation?

Ask a Work Claims lawyer in Parkwood

Arbitration involves a binding decision by an arbitrator, while mediation seeks a mutually agreed resolution facilitated by a mediator.;Mediation is usually less formal and focuses on negotiation and settlement.
